RHSA-2024:4051: Important: pki-core security update
Important: pki-core security update
Other sources
The Public Key Infrastructure (PKI) Core contains fundamental packages required by Red Hat Certificate System.Security Fix(es): dogtag ca: token authentication bypass vulnerability (CVE-2023-4727) For more details about the security issue(s), including the impact, a CVSS score, acknowledgments, and other related information, refer to the CVE page(s) listed in the References section.

What is the severity of RHSA-2024:4051?
The severity of RHSA-2024:4051 is classified as important.
What vulnerability is addressed by RHSA-2024:4051?
RHSA-2024:4051 addresses a token authentication bypass vulnerability identified as CVE-2023-4727.
How do I fix RHSA-2024:4051?
To fix RHSA-2024:4051, update the pki-core package to version 11.3.0-2.el9_2 or later.
Which software is affected by RHSA-2024:4051?
RHSA-2024:4051 affects several variants of Red Hat Enterprise Linux, including x86_64, Power, ARM, and IBM z Systems.
Is there a specific package version required to resolve RHSA-2024:4051?
Yes, the required package version to resolve RHSA-2024:4051 is 11.3.0-2.el9_2 for various affected packages.
